The Latin (scientific) name for the silkworm is bombyx mori, which means "silkworm of the black mulberry tree". These moths are flightless and do not have a mouth so they are unable to consume food. Silkworm definition is - a moth whose larva spins a large amount of strong silk in constructing its cocoon; especially : an Asian moth (Bombyx mori of the family Bombycidae) whose rough wrinkled hairless caterpillar produces the silk of commerce. The Silkworm (Bombyx mori) is the caterpillar of a moth whose cocoon is used to make silk; it is not a worm at all.This insect is also called the silkworm-moth and the mulberry silkworm.
